Sound Transit trains will take passengers across Lake Washington starting at 10 a.m. Saturday. It’s the world’s first light rail train to cross floating bridge, according to the agency.
Tens of thousands of riders came out to ride the 2 Line across Lake Washington Saturday, as Sound Transit inaugurated the light rail link between the east and west metro.
